What does Islene mean?

Islene particulary is used in Irish is a girl name. It is rooted from Irish, meaning of Islene is "Dream or Vision". Islene is a variant of widespread Aisling. Originated from Celtic and Irish, Aisling, Aisling means "Dream, Vision and Dream, Vision".
